Description
Ageless Quest is a personal, sometimes controversial, account of the pursuit of a genetic 'cure' for aging by an expert in the field. The author is the Novartis Professor of Biology at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ology. Aging has always been regarded as a highly complex process with many degenerative changes leading to the cessation of life. But recent research has identified a relatively simple mechanism that governs the pace of aging. Lenny Guarente's Ageless Quest is a scientific detective story for the baby boom generation. It offers an insider's view of an area of potentially astonishing high reward-and equally high risk.
Table of Contents
Preface Chapter 1 Mid-life crisis Chapter 2 Getting started in aging Chapter 3 First genetic insight Chapter 4 Identification of the AGE locus Chapter 5 The rise and fall of rDNA circles and the emergence of SIR2 Chapter 6 A molecular blueprint for prolonging life span Chapter 7 SIR2 as a universal regulator of survival Chapter 8 Nature promotes survival in the face of scarcity Chapter 9 Theories of aging: SIR2 is more evolutionary than revolutionary Chapter 10 Calorie restriction and life span Chapter 11 Aging and cancer in mammals Chapter 12 Relevance to human aging Chapter 13 Starting a biotechnology company: Drugs for aging? Chapter 14 Aging gracefully in the 21st century Snapshots Bibliography Glossary Index
